Output 5a59593235009c2dcf0a59e8902eeb8fe5d9eba4cc964e6442e7c4dd57197514:16

value
10223640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a22f889a1c343055da76072c3c115d1fb001800c OP_EQUAL
address
A7Dq5AATysbskBJRog2yW13jiU5gzXXLUF
transaction
5a59593235009c2dcf0a59e8902eeb8fe5d9eba4cc964e6442e7c4dd57197514